The show Ornitópera was awarded twice at the Young Audience Music Awards (YAMAwards)'24, winning in the Best Opera and Audience Choice categories. Created by Paulo Maria Rodrigues, an integrated researcher at the INET-md and resident composer at the Companhia de Música Teatral (CMT), the work stands out among international productions for young audiences.

The YAMAwards aim to identify and support productions from all over the world that inspire and engage young people and distinguish the creativity and innovation of musical productions for audiences in this age group. The prizes are awarded by Jeunesses Musicales International (JMI), an organization that stands out for arguing that access to music and culture are fundamental rights for all children and young people.

Ornitópera is a music theater show designed for "kids and grown-ups". "One day, all the birds of the world gathered in a great assembly to deal with the serious problems they were all facing. We don't know why humans weren't invited, perhaps because they caused most of them."

This is a story about birds, which is also a poem or a metaphor about what is deepest about human beings. There are no words at the beginning, no words in the middle, and even less at the end. In Ornithoptera he communicates through music. The language of birds.

The show Ornitópera is a co-production of CMT with Casa das Artes de Vila Nova de Famalicão and Teatro Aveirense and is one of the results of CMT's partnership with UAveiro which, since 1999, has allowed an effective articulation between academic research, artistic production, technological creation, community involvement and the dissemination of the importance of musical experience and art in general in social and human development.

Projects and creations such as Bach2Cage, Pianoscope or Porcelain and Crystal Gamelan are some examples of the results of this partnership. Several of CMT's founding members and collaborators are linked to two of the country's most important research centers (CESEM and INET-md), the Faculty of Social Sciences and Humanities of the New Faculty of Lisbon (NOVA-FCSH) and UAveiro, contributing to relevant university outreach work and making art available to everyone.
